Transaction b84be176eb39f772012f4a4b50312f9a67e800081b04a9a96ee36ef3725b91e4
1 Input
1 Output
-
b84be176eb39f772012f4a4b50312f9a67e800081b04a9a96ee36ef3725b91e4:0
- value
- 3665855
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bb7a369ce062c5a2bf23ae39754608deb6f56a0d OP_EQUAL
- address
- 3JnJgwtWg1XEHEzd9Cm3RXhGejc62v98hP